c4SMC: Industry Solutions as a Service
An industry collaboration initiative embracing smart technologies and processes in delivering a modern construction industry.
Vision
To be a world-leading industry-focused construction research and training centre utilising concepts and technologies brought forward by the 4th Industrial Revolution.
Mission
To contribute to the development of a smart modern construction industry that is capable of dealing with the challenges of sustainability, digitalisation, industrialisation, supply chain, resilience, design, management & economics, and education, which are proactively responded to through academic, industry, professional bodies and government collaboration.
Goals
- Offer High Achiever construction management scholarships.
- Explore research grant opportunities.
- Host visiting academics and industry experts.
- Encourage academic and research exchange.
- Establish DigiCon lab: A state-of-the-art digital construction laboratory for research, development, and training solutions.
- Provide consultancy services to the construction sector.
- Upskill the construction sector with cutting-edge technologies.
- Develop policy directions for the construction sector.
- Provide a platform to engage with construction stakeholders.
- Conduct doctoral research.
- Develop a collaborative research culture that also engages the industry.

Digital Built Environment Research Colloquium 2025: Strengthening Research Collaboration
The Centre for Smart Modern Construction (c4SMC) at the School of Engineering, Design and Built Environment, in collaboration with the (Arch_Manu) at the University of New South Wales, hosted the Digital Built Environment Research Colloquium 2025 on 14 March 2025 at 91ԭƬ’s Parramatta City Campus. This dynamic event provided a collaborative platform for doctoral and postdoctoral researchers from both centres to exchange ideas, explore recent advancements, and foster potential research partnerships in the digital built environment.
Vice-Chancellor’s Award for Excellence in Postgraduate Research, Training and Supervision 2024: Professor Srinath Perera
Professor Srinath Perera received the Vice-Chancellor’s Award for Excellence in Postgraduate Research, Training and Supervision at the 91ԭƬ Excellence Awards Ceremony, held on 12 December 2024. He was selected from among seven nominees.
Book publication: Global Net Zero Carbon Practices in Construction
We are thrilled to announce the upcoming release of a new book: "Global Net Zero Carbon Practices in Construction," edited by Niluka Domingo, Sepani Senaratne , Suzanne Wilkinson, and Srinath Perera. This book brings together global expertise to address one of the most pressing challenges in the construction industry: achieving net zero carbon.
